The Opportunity:
Due to Maitland City Council's commitment to ongoing asset management maturity, our team is experiencing significant growth with a number of new opportunities available!
Our Community Asset Engineers play a key role in the strategic planning and long-term management of Council's community and recreation assets. Working across a diverse asset portfolio including buildings, public open spaces, recreation facilitates, cemeteries and aquatic centres you will develop and maintain service asset management plans.
You will contribute to Council's Capital Works Program through the development of Project Initiation Briefs for Community and Recreational Capital Works projects and will provide technical advice to support the long-term management of Council's assets.
A key function of your role will include maintaining asset data registers, supporting asset valuations and revaluations and providing professional advice to help ensure Council's community assets continue to meet service levels and the needs of our growing community.
